Is your village hall, sports club or social club feeling the strain? We’re offering grants up to £5,000 to help you invest in your building’s future – whether that’s better heating, making access easier, or improvements that bring your community together.
What we fund:
- Energy efficiency and green improvements
- Accessibility upgrades
- Building work that helps you serve your community better
- Equipment that keeps your venue sustainable long-term
Applicants should demonstrate how the proposed improvements will benefit the wider community and help the organisation remain viable into the future.
This fund will not support activities but is looking to support the sustainability of community venues who provide a safe and warm spaces for residents.
Funding available
£100,000 available. There is no minimum grant, but the maximum grant available is £5,000.
Geographical focus
Leicester, Leicestershire, Rutland, Nottingham, Nottinghamshire, Derby & Derbyshire

Timescale
Applications open 9am Monday 14th September 2026
Applications close 9am Monday 19 October 2026
Decisions to be made by Monday 23rd November 2026
Funded activity to take place from 1st January 2027 – 31st December 2027
